Social: Like Actions is a Plone package (add-on) providing simple social networks integration for Plone Content Types.

This package ships with plugins for the following networks:

  • Facebook

  • Google+

  • LinkedIn

  • Pinterest

  • Twitter

  • WhatsApp (mobile only)

Installation

To enable this product in a buildout-based installation:

  1. Edit your buildout.cfg and add sc.social.like to the list of eggs to install:

    [buildout]
    ...
    eggs =
        sc.social.like

After updating the configuration you need to run ‘’bin/buildout’’, which will take care of updating your system.

Go to the ‘Site Setup’ page in a Plone site and click on the ‘Add-ons’ link.

Check the box next to Social: Like Actions and click the ‘Activate’ button.

Configuration

Go to the ‘Site Setup’ page in the Plone interface and click on the ‘Social Like’ link – under Add-on Configuration.

https://github.com/collective/sc.social.like/raw/master/docs/control_panel.png

There you can configure how Social: Like Actions will behave, which actions will be displayed and for which content types.

Privacy and cookies

Social networks and privacy togheter is a thorny argument, let say that social media widget commonly tracks user actions and add 3rd party cookies.

If privacy is something you must care about (for example: if you need to take care of the European Cookie Law) sc.social.like provide a “Do not track users” option. When enabled, social media widget are rendered as simple HTML links at the expense of features and user experience.

This product is also respecting the Do Not Track browser user’s preference. If the user configured his browser for beeing not tracked, social media will be rendered as the “Severe privacy” settings is enabled.
